Interior design is the creative art and science of boosting the interiors, including the exterior sometimes, of an area or building, to achieve a wholesome and even more aesthetically satisfying environment for the end individual. An interior designer is somebody who plans, researches, coordinates, and manages such projects. Interior design is a multifaceted occupation which includes conceptual development, space planning, site inspections, coding, research, connecting with the stakeholders of an project, building management, and execution of the design.

Interior design is the procedure of shaping the knowledge of interior space, through the manipulation of spatial volume level as well as surface treatment for the betterment of human being functionality.

Interior designer implies that there is certainly more of an emphasis on planning, efficient design and the effective use of space, when compared with interior decorating. An inside designer can carry out projects that include arranging the basic layout of spaces in just a building as well as jobs that require an understanding of technological issues such as window and door placement, acoustics, and lamps. Although an inside custom may create the layout of a space, they might not alter load-bearing wall space without having their designs stamped for endorsement by the structural engineer. Interior designers work immediately with architects often, engineers and contractors.

Interior designers must be highly skilled in order to create interior surroundings that are practical, safe, and stick to building codes, regulations and ADA requirements. They go beyond the selection of color palettes and furnishings and apply their knowledge to the development of construction documents, occupancy loads, healthcare regulations and sustainable design principles, as well as the coordination and management of professional services including m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and life safety--all to ensure that people can live, learn or work in an innocuous environment that is visually pleasing also.

Someone may decide to concentrate and develop complex knowledge specific to one area or type of interior design, such as residential design, commercial design, hospitality design, medical design, widespread design, exhibition design, furniture design, and spatial branding. Interior design is a creative job that is new relatively, constantly evolving, and baffling to the general public often. It isn't an artistic pursuit and depends on research from many fields to provide a well-trained knowledge of how people are influenced by their environments.

Color in interior design

Color is a powerful design tool in decorating, and home design which is the creative skill of composition, and coordinates colors together to produce stylish system. Interior designers have understanding of colors to comprehend psychological effects, and meaning of each color to create suitable combinations for every single accepted place. Combining Color also provides certain mind-set, and has negative and positive results. It makes a available room feel more calm, cheerful, comfortable or dramatic. It also makes a tiny room seem to be larger or smaller. So it is the inside designer profession to choose appropriate colors for a location in a way people want to appear and feel in the space.

Home Insurance Tips

Homeowners' insurance isn't a luxury, it's essential. In fact, most mortgage companies won't make financing or funding a home real estate business deal unless the buyer provides proof of coverage for the entire or reasonable value of the property (more often than not this is actually the price). In this article, we'll demonstrate some simple activities you can take to be sure your homeowners' insurance is enough for your needs.

Homeowners' insurance can be quite expensive. Those that are in high-risk areas such as close to major waterways, known earthquake problem lines or other high claims areas will pay the most for coverage. Actually, those in high-risk areas are often forced to pay gross annual premiums in the many thousands. But homeowners in relatively sedate even, suburban neighborhoods (with property prices around the nationwide average of $210,000) could pay between $500 and $1,000 a full time for a basic policy.

The glad tidings are that although you can't (and shouldn't) avoid purchasing homeowners' insurance, there are ways to minimize the cost.

Listed below are six ways to be sure to receive the right coverage and consequent reimbursement for your home:

1) Maintain a Security System and Smoke cigarettes Alarms: A security alarm that is supervised with a central station, or that is tied to a local authorities train station straight, will help lower the homeowner's annual prices, perhaps by 5% or more. To be able to obtain the discount, the homeowner must typically provide proof central monitoring by means of a costs or a deal to the insurance company.Smoke cigars alarms are another biggie. While standard in most modern houses, setting up them in old homes can save the property owner 10% or more in annual monthly premiums. Of course, more importantly even, in case of fire, they could save your life!

2) INCREASE YOUR Deductible: Like health insurance or car insurance, the higher the deductible the owner of a house chooses, the low the annual monthly premiums. However, the situation with choosing the high deductible is the fact that smaller cases/problems such as broken windows or ruined sheetrock from a leaky pipe, which typically will definitely cost only a few hundred us dollars to repair, will most likely be absorbed by the homeowner.

3) Search for Multiple Policy Special discounts: Many insurance companies give a discount of 10% or even more to their customers that maintain other insurance agreements under the same roofing (such as vehicle or medical health insurance). Consider obtaining a quote for other styles of insurance from the same company that delivers your homeowners' insurance. You might end up saving on two total annual policy premiums.

4) Plan Ahead for Building: In the event the homeowner plans to construct an addition to the house or another composition adjacent to the home, he or the materials should be considered by her that will be used. Typically, wood-framed structures (because they're highly flammable) will cost more to insure. Conversely, cement- or steel-framed structures will cost less since it is less likely to succumb to flames or adverse weather conditions.

Another thing that a lot of homeowners should, but often don't, consider is the insurance costs associated with building a swimming pool. In fact, items such as swimming pools and/or other potentially injurious devices (like trampolines) can drive total annual homeowners' insurance costs up by 10% or more. This may seem like a small price to pay given the happiness these things bring, but it continues to be something that needs to be considered by the homeowner prior to purchase or construction.

5) PAY BACK Your Home loan: Obviously this is easier said than done, but homeowners that pay off their mortgage bad debts will likely see their premiums drop. Why? The simple reason is that the insurance provider numbers that if you own the home outright, you'll take better care of it.

6) Make Regular Plan Reviews and Evaluations: Traders should, at least once per yr, compare the expenses of other insurance policies to their own. Furthermore, they have to review their existing insurance plan and make note of any changes that may have occurred which could lower their prices.

For example, possibly the home-owner has disassembled the trampoline, paid the home loan, installed a burglar alarm or installed a superior sprinkler system inside his or her home. If this is actually the circumstance, simply notifying the insurance provider of the change(s) and providing proofs in the form of pictures and/or receipts could significantly lower insurance premiums.Search for changes in a nearby which could reduce rates as well. For instance, the installation of a flame hydrant within 100 toes of the home, or the erection of an flames substation within close closeness to the property may lower the homeowner's annual premiums.
